Bachelor of Fine Arts
The BFA in Fine Arts is a professional degree for students who want intensive study of the visual arts. The BFA is comprised of five areas of emphasis.
• Ceramics
• Drawing and Painting
• Graphic Design
• Photography
• Printmaking
Students can apply for the BFA after successfully completing the Foundation Portfolio Review.
DEGREE REQUIREMENTS: 124 semester hours, 52 total hours taken in the Art and Design Department.

NOTE: Some courses required in the major will also fulfill requirements for the University core curriculum. Students should always meet with a faculty advisor for information on course scheduling, course rotation, course selection and to plan the most efficient program of study.
All students must participate in the MUW Juried Student Exhibition in the freshman, sophomore, and junior years, and in the senior exhibition.
Minors
Students majoring in another department may wish to enhance their education with a minor in art history or general art.· The Art History Minor consists of a series of humanities courses focusing on the history of art. The General Art Minor is a combination of hands-on studio experience with some art history.
Art History Minor
DEGREE REQUIREMENTS: To graduate with a minor in Art History, you must complete 18 semester hours in the Department of Art and Design.

Studio Art Minor
DEGREE REQUIREMENTS: To graduate with a general art minor, you must complete 24 semester hours in the Art and Design Department.
